One PhD (4 years) and one postdoctoral position (2-3 years) are available in the Landry Laboratory at Laval University (http://www.bio.ulaval.ca/landrylab). The candidate will work on a project funded by the Canadian Institutes of Health Research that aims at understanding the molecular and evolutionary mechanisms of robustness of protein networks and protein complexes using large-scale proteomics approaches. The Landry laboratory is a very dynamic, international and interdisciplinary research group with broad interests in systems biology, molecular evolution, bioinformatics and ecological genomics. The applicants should have a strong background in molecular biology, microbiology, biochemistry and/or proteomics. The projects are mainly experimental but candidates with strong computational backgrounds who are willing to learn and perform experimental research are encouraged to apply. Previous work in yeast genetics and genomics would be an asset.
Laval University is one of the most important research universities in Canada and is located in Quebec City, a lively city with a vibrant culture that offers an exceptional quality of life.
